In this week’s episode right on the heels of the 1st “CANNAVERSARY” of the legalization of recreational cannabis in Canada and launch of cannabis retail, and with the new cannabis edible 2.0 regime coming into force, three exclusive interviews live from Vancouver at this week’s Retail Council of Canada Retail West event  with cannabis retailers and regulatory experts as they came off the main stage. First up is Eleanor Lynch, Senior Vice President of Retail Operations at Kiaro.  We reflect together on the year that was, and learn about Kiaro’s interesting approach to in store and brand design. Next Adam Coates, Chief Commercial Officer Westleaf Inc. takes us through their unique retail concept Prairie Records, how they approached developing the brand and how 2.0 and the new edibles regime will allow retailers to introduce product that will bring in the “canna-curious customers who are looking for alternatives to what is available at retail today. Finally RCC’s Avery Bruenjes Policy Analyst, Government Relations and Regulatory Affairs weighs in with her perspective around the government regulatory framework informed by years of dealing with multiple files and issues.
